Frontal Snowsquall Posted November 26, 2019 Report Share Posted November 26, 2019 New blog post from Mark. This is the most excited I've been with a storm that's gonna miss me. 'The “explosive cyclogenesis” is still forecast to occur off the Oregon coastline the next 24 hours. That’s sometimes called “bombogenesis“, a “meteorological bomb”, or even a “bomb cyclone”. The 18z ECMWF model takes a 1010 mb low down to 970 mb as it moves onto the coastline somewhere around Brookings. That’s 40 millibars in less than 24 hours! Luckily the track means most of the big wind is offshore and the southerly movement “takes away” from the southerly wind gusts over land.' https://www.kptv.com/weather/blog/southern-oregon-storm-tomorrow-still-no-snow-expected-metro-area/article_7dd5e438-0ff3-11ea-9d6b-af814e27efac.html 3 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Deweydog Posted November 26, 2019 Report Share Posted November 26, 2019 It’s an impressive bomb but it’s not particularly analogous to a traditional sou’wester bombing out to sub-970mb. Lacks much jet support, no low level barrier jet and like Mark said its trajectory doesn’t help. In the end I think this thing is gonna get labeled an underperformer from a wind perspective.
